I actually made two Christmas Cards this year. I usually make a bunch of the same but decided after making 20 of one card, I wanted to do something different. There were so many wonderful Christmas stamp sets in the Holiday Catalog that I had a hard time choosing. The first card I made used the stamp set called Star Of Light. This set has matching Thinlits called Starlight. I think this set is so elegant.
The second card I made was more cute than elegant. I used the stamp set called Santa’s Sleigh and the matching Thinlits (also called Santa’s Sleigh). The sentiment is from Merriest Wishes and the Designer Series Paper is called This Christmas.
